Lynne Jackson

Lynne Jackson is currently in her 46th year as a music educator. She has degrees from the University of Michigan and Vandercook College of Music. Ms. Jackson is an Adjunct Assistant Professor of Music Education at Southern Methodist University and also is a mentor teacher for the Berkner area in Richardson, Texas. Ms. Jackson has traveled and taught throughout Europe, Asia, South America and Canada. For the past six years, Ms. Jackson has also established a relationship with the state of Singapore where she has worked to develop curriculum and pedagogy with music educators and students on two separate occasions. In 2010, Ms. Jackson was awarded the Meritorious Achievement Award by the Texas Bandmaster’s Association. Her additional affiliations include the Texas Music Educator Association and Phi Beta Mu. Lynne is the founder of Young Educator Seminars, YES, which offers continuing professional development to North Texas music educators and she also serves on the board of the Lone Star Wind Orchestra. Lynne is widely known throughout Texas as a clinician, and mentor to young students and teachers.
